A chipped tooth, a small gap between the front teeth, a tooth that's shorter or darker than its neighbours: these details show, and they can start to bother you. Cosmetic dentistry covers the treatments that correct them — veneers, composite bonding, reshaping.

Our approach is simple: as little intervention as possible for a result that looks natural. It all starts with a consultation, where we listen, examine and show you what's possible before you decide.

What to expect

  1. Step 1

    Consultation

    We talk about what's bothering you, examine your teeth, gums and bite, and take photos. Sometimes the solution is simpler than you imagined.

  2. Step 2

    Options

    The dentist walks you through the choices — bonding, a veneer, reshaping, or sometimes whitening or aligners first — with the pros and limits of each. You decide, no pressure.

  3. Step 3

    The treatment

    Bonding and reshaping are often done in a single visit, with little or no anaesthesia. Veneers usually take two visits: preparation and impression, then placement.

  4. Step 4

    Adjustments and follow-up

    We check the shape, the colour and how it feels when you chew. At cleaning visits, we keep an eye on wear and polish as needed.
